Complementary Goods

are products or services that are used together, where the use or consumption of one increases the demand for the other.

Close-Substitute

A good or service that can easily replace another in satisfying consumer needs, with very little change in consumption patterns.

Consumer Preferences

The tastes, preferences, and priorities that individuals have regarding the consumption of goods and services.
